Detailed requirements:
AWS configuration
o Adobe AMI has to be transformed to EC2 instance – to be able to stop. The whole Adobe Media Server installation and AWS configuration will be done automatically (Cloud Formation).
o Ftp server
o Wowza – installation and configuration to use Cloud Front
Adobe Media Server 5.0
o Server has to be configured to capture live streamed video on the server side and store it on S3 or EBS. The captured video files have to be stored according to the provided logic (unique names of files, storing in dedicated folders – one user can have one or more videos).
o Server has to handle concurrent upload live video streams – limited by VM power (m1.large or m1.xlarge instance type). Live streamed video can be watched by a dedicated user on many devices at the same time (regular PCs, mobile devices). It is planned to broadcast the live streamed video to many users.
o Concurrent VOD handling – many users can watch numerous videos at the same time.
Testing
o Selenium grid configuration or some other solution to concurrent tests – up to 100 concurrent live streams (upload)
Documentation
o Detailed documentation needs to be provided with links to the used tools and descriptions of the implemented configurations.
Source Code
o Source Code of the used scripts or other developed solutions, needs to be provided
Wowza
o The same requirements as in case of the Adobe Media Server
